Summary/Abstract: The article deals with issues related to stress and burnout at teacher’s work. This phenomenon inevitably accompanies every human being. The teaching profession is particularly exposed to stress, it belongs to the group of so-called social and assistance professions acting for the benefit of another person or a group of people. This work includes both psychosocial and physical burdens. The author presents the results of research on the level of perceived stress, identification of stress factors, the most common symptoms of stress, as well as the ways teachers cope with such situations and burnout.
